Material Composition and Structural Integrity

The foundation of a high-performance waterproof stand-up pouch lies in its material composition. While the core keyword specifies BOPP, the actual construction often involves a multi-layer composite structure to achieve the desired barrier properties. In many commercial applications, the pouch is not made of a single layer of BOPP but rather a laminate of materials such as BOPP/VMPET/PE, PET/VMPET/PE, or PET/PE. The inclusion of VMPET (Vacuum Metallized Polyethylene Terephthalate) is a common strategy to enhance the moisture barrier and light protection, which is essential for products like coffee beans, dry fruits, and powders.

When evaluating a potential supplier, buyers must scrutinize the raw material specifications. The presence of High Pressure Polyethylene (PE) or Nylon (NY) layers often complements the BOPP outer layer to provide sealability and mechanical strength. For instance, a specification of "BOPP/VMPET/PE" suggests a structure where the outer layer offers printability and rigidity, the middle layer provides the moisture barrier, and the inner PE layer ensures a hermetic heat seal. It is crucial to verify that the "Waterproof Performance" claim is backed by the specific layer configuration rather than a generic assertion. The "Food Grade" status of these materials is non-negotiable for applications involving food, coffee, or candy, ensuring that no harmful substances migrate into the product.

Technical Specifications and Customization Parameters

Technical specifications define the physical capabilities of the pouch. The "Stand up pouch" model, often categorized under "Square Bottom Bag" or "Upright Bag," requires precise dimensional accuracy to ensure stability on retail shelves. Observed industry data indicates that sizes can vary significantly, ranging from specific dimensions like 105mm (W) x 155mm (L) + 80mm (B) to fully customized requirements. The "Size" attribute is frequently listed as "Customized," allowing buyers to tailor the pouch to their specific product volume and shape.

The sealing mechanism is another critical technical factor. Most high-quality stand-up pouches utilize a "Heat Seal" process, which creates a strong bond between the inner layers. The "Surface" finish is typically achieved through "Gravure Printing," a method that allows for high-resolution graphics and vibrant colors. Buyers should note that the color capacity often extends "up to 10 Colors," enabling complex branding designs. Additionally, the "Sealing & Handle" feature, such as a zipper or spout, must be integrated seamlessly. For example, a "Spout Pouch" or "Stand up zipper bag" adds functionality for dispensing liquids or powders, but this requires precise engineering to maintain the waterproof integrity of the main body.

Compliance, Certification, and Safety Standards

In the B2B procurement landscape, compliance is a primary filter for supplier selection. While specific certification statuses can vary by manufacturer, the industry standard for food-grade packaging often includes ISO 9001, BRC-IOP, HACCP, and QS certifications. These standards ensure that the manufacturing process adheres to rigorous quality management and food safety protocols. When sourcing waterproof BOPP pouches, buyers should explicitly request proof of these certifications to verify that the supplier maintains a controlled environment free from contamination.

The "Food Grade" attribute is a mandatory requirement for any pouch intended for direct contact with consumables like snacks, frozen food, or meat. However, buyers must be cautious not to assume that all listed products automatically satisfy every certification. The presence of a certification claim should be treated as an observation that requires validation through documentation. For industrial uses, such as "Washing Powder" or "Chemical Packaging," the focus shifts slightly toward chemical resistance and structural durability, though the "Moisture Proof" feature remains a universal necessity.

Cost Drivers and Economic Considerations

Understanding the cost structure of waterproof BOPP stand-up pouches is essential for budgeting and negotiation. The price is influenced by several variables, including the complexity of the material structure, the number of printing colors, and the order quantity. The "MOQ" (Minimum Order Quantity) range observed in the market can be substantial, spanning from 300 to 100,000 units. This wide range indicates that suppliers may offer different pricing tiers based on volume, with smaller orders potentially carrying a higher unit cost due to setup and machine changeover expenses.

Lead time is another significant economic factor. Typical delivery windows range from 18 to 25 days, depending on the quantity ordered and the complexity of the customization. Buyers should account for this lead time in their supply chain planning to avoid stockouts. Furthermore, the "Customization" availability, while offering flexibility, can introduce additional costs related to mold creation, design proofing, and material sourcing. The "Small Orders: Accepted" attribute suggests that some suppliers are willing to accommodate lower volumes, which can be beneficial for startups or test runs, though the per-unit cost will likely be higher than bulk purchases.

Quality Control and Performance Verification

Quality control (QC) is the backbone of a successful procurement strategy. For waterproof BOPP pouches, the primary concern is maintaining the integrity of the seal and the barrier properties. The "Feature" list often includes "Moisture Proof," "Recyclable," and "Bio-Degradable," but these attributes must be verified through testing. The "Gravure Printed" surface should be checked for color consistency and adhesion, as poor printing quality can indicate underlying issues with the material or process.

Buyers should implement a rigorous QC protocol that includes visual inspection of the "Heat Seal" strength and dimensional accuracy. The "Shape" of the pouch, whether "Square Bottom Bag" or "Plastic Bags," must be consistent to ensure proper filling and stacking. For applications involving "Powder, Food, Coffee Bean, Candy, Meat, Dry Fruit," the "Disposable" nature of the packaging must not compromise the safety of the contents. The "Shock Resistance" feature is particularly relevant for products that may experience rough handling during logistics. It is advisable to request test results or certificates of analysis that confirm the "Waterproof Performance" and "Food Grade" status before finalizing large orders.
